2019 RSD to DKK Performance & Market Timing Review

Analysis of key historical highlights and timing insights for 2019

During 2019, the RSD to DKK exchange rate experienced significant fluctuation. The market reached its absolute peak on January 2, valuing the pair at 0.0644. Conversely, the yearly low was recorded on January 7, dropping to 0.0626.

This high-to-low spread represents a total annual volatility of 0.0018 DKK. From a start-to-finish perspective, comparing the January average rate of 0.0631 to the December average rate of 0.0636, the exchange rate registered a net change of 0.78% (reflecting a strengthening trend).

Looking at year-over-year peak valuations, the 2019 high of 0.0644 was up 1.14% compared to the 2018 peak of 0.0637, indicating shifts in long-term support levels.

Monthly Breakdown

Statistical summary for each calendar month.

Month High Low Average
January 0.0644 0.0626 0.0631
February 0.0633 0.0630 0.0631
March 0.0634 0.0631 0.0632
April 0.0634 0.0631 0.0633
May 0.0634 0.0633 0.0633
June 0.0635 0.0633 0.0633
July 0.0635 0.0633 0.0634
August 0.0637 0.0632 0.0634
September 0.0640 0.0633 0.0635
October 0.0636 0.0635 0.0636
November 0.0637 0.0635 0.0636
December 0.0636 0.0635 0.0636
